Social Achievements

  • Increased physical activity among children and youth in rural Vanuatu.
  • Trained young men and women as Community Sport Leaders.
  • Strengthened community leadership and governance through training and support.
  • Improved health and fitness levels in participating communities.
  • Increased unity and reduced anti-social behavior in communities.

Governance Achievements

  • Established a three-way partnership between MYDST, VASANOC, and Internal Affairs for program delivery.
  • Developed a robust monitoring and evaluation framework.
  • Implemented a risk management strategy to address potential challenges.

Environmental Challenges

  • Limited resources and infrastructure in rural areas.
  • Low prioritization of sport in communities.
  • Lack of technical skills and structure for sport in provinces.
  • Low levels of support from national organizations.
  • Maintaining youth leader activity after program contact is reduced.
  • Ensuring equitable participation of women and girls.
  • Potential for conflict with traditional gender roles.
Mitigation Strategies
  • Targeted assistance to two provinces.
  • Capacity building at community, provincial, and national levels.
  • Use of existing structures and systems.
  • Community education and awareness campaigns.
  • Mentoring and support for youth leaders.
  • 50% female quota in Sport Leader Apprenticeship.
  • Gender training for staff and community leaders.
  • Flexible program design to adapt to community needs.
  • Action research approach to monitoring and evaluation.
